β‐Galactosidase Activity as a Biomarker of Replicative Senescence during the Course of Human Fibroblast Cultures
1 Apr 2007
Abstract excerpt
It has been called into question whether the commonly used beta-galactosidase staining is a reliable biomarker of cellular senescence because induction of beta-galactosidase activity also occurs independently of senescence. Here, we tested whether cytochemically detectable beta-galactosidase activity is reproducible and reflects the rate of cellular aging in vitro. Therefore, we serially cultured fibroblasts from...
